Transaction 33f76b3c2f974ebc50d7dd74fbee08946faf830788b83299927201c035f72aa4
1 Input
2 Outputs
- 33f76b3c2f974ebc50d7dd74fbee08946faf830788b83299927201c035f72aa4:0
- 33f76b3c2f974ebc50d7dd74fbee08946faf830788b83299927201c035f72aa4:1
value 51578160
address 17M6y4bPCeGmnEa8Cn3ZC7HPfX6aD2yxhn
value 51203700
address 12GKPky8MyQqwgwP7jKX6LC7fjPNfMoSTq